什么是区块链钱包合约?
区块链钱包合约是结合了区块链技术与智能合约的一种新型数字资产存储方式。传统的数字货币钱包通常仅用于存储和转账加密资产,而区块链钱包合约则通过智能合约的功能,提供更丰富的操作和管理机制。最常见的应用场景包括以太坊钱包合约,它允许用户在合约中设置特定规则,自动执行交易、管理资产,甚至进行去中心化金融(DeFi)操作。
区块链钱包合约的工作原理
区块链钱包合约的工作原理相对复杂,其核心在于智能合约的自动执行。首先,用户通过钱包合约部署自己的资产,例如以太或ERC-20代币。在这个合约中,用户可以定义各种规则,比如转账的条件、交易的限额,甚至是多重签名机制。这些规则一旦被设置,就会被存储在区块链上,并在区块链网络中自动执行,确保资金安全以及操作的透明。
例如,当用户希望在特定时间内将资产转账给另一个地址时,可以在合约中设置一个时间戳和接收地址。当条件满足时,智能合约会自动完成转账,而用户无需手动操作。这种方式不仅提高了交易效率,还减少了人为错误和欺诈的风险。
区块链钱包合约的优势
区块链钱包合约具有多个显著优势,以下是几个关键点:
- 安全性:由于所有操作都由区块链网络记录并加密,区块链钱包合约提供了比传统钱包更高的安全性。只要私钥不泄露,用户的数字资产就能得到有效保护。
- 去中心化:区块链技术的去中心化特性使得用户不再依赖于中心化的第三方机构进行资产存储和管理,降低了信任成本和潜在风险。
- 灵活性:用户可以在合约中自定义多种操作规则,灵活满足具体需求。这为机构和个人用户开辟了更多的应用场景。
- 透明度和可追溯性:所有的交易记录都会被写入区块链,这使得每一笔转账都可以被追溯,增加了交易的透明度。
区块链钱包合约的应用场景
越来越多的企业和个人用户开始认识到区块链钱包合约的潜力,它们的应用场景也不断扩展:
- 去中心化金融(DeFi):DeFi平台利用钱包合约进行自动化交易、借贷与换汇等,为用户提供灵活的金融服务。
- 众筹与首次代币发行(ICO):智能合约可用于管理资金流动,确保只有在达成特定条件时才会释放资金。
- 数字身份和个人数据管理:钱包合约能够帮助用户管理自己的数字身份,保障用户数据安全。
- 游戏资产管理:游戏中虚拟资产的拥有权和转让也可以通过钱包合约来管理,提升用户体验。
围绕区块链钱包合约的可能相关问题
1. 如何评估区块链钱包合约的安全性?
评估区块链钱包合约的安全性是用户在使用之前必须考虑的问题。首先,了解合约的审计过程非常重要。许多可信赖的区块链项目会对其智能合约进行第三方安全审计。用户可以查看审计报告,了解合约是否存在漏洞或安全隐患。
其次,合约的代码质量是关键因素。用户可以查看合约的开源代码,评估其逻辑是否清晰、实现是否合理。另外,社区的反馈和用户的使用经历也是评估合约安全性的参考。在大型区块链社区中,经验丰富的开发者会分享他们对不同合约的看法,这能为新用户提供良好的参考信息。
此外,使用合约时应降低风险。用户可以选择小额资金进行测试,确保交易的顺利进行后再进行大量转账。在使用合约功能时,亦应遵循最佳实践,避免因操作不当导致资产损失。
2. 区块链钱包合约的未来发展趋势是什么?
随着区块链技术的不断发展,钱包合约的未来也呈现出多种趋势。首先,跨链钱包合约的开发愈加重要。当前大多数钱包合约仅限于特定链的资产管理,未来将逐渐实现跨链技术,允许用户在不同区块链之间自由转移资产。
其次,用户体验的改善将是一个重要发展方向。随着技术的进步,开发团队越来越注重合约的可用性和用户界面设计,这将吸引更多非技术用户进入区块链领域。通过开发简易操作的标准化钱包合约产品,能够降低用户的学习成本。
此外,随着金融科技的快速发展,钱包合约将可能与更多金融服务相结合,产生创新的金融产品。例如,自动化投资、风险管理等新兴概念都有望与钱包合约紧密结合,构建起更加合理和高效的金融生态。
3. 如何选择合适的区块链钱包合约?
选择合适的区块链钱包合约是用户进行有效资产管理的重要步骤。首先,用户应考虑自己需要的合约功能,比如是否支持多重签名或多资产管理。如果用户需要进行复杂的交易,还应查看合约支持的功能是否满足需求,如自动支付、定时交易等。
其次,了解合约的用户反馈和社区支持情况也很重要。一个受欢迎的合约通常意味着它经过大量用户使用,较为稳定。如有负面反馈,用户应仔细分析原因,决定是否继续使用该产品。
此外,合约所运行的区块链的性能与费用也是考虑因素。用户需要注意交易确认速度、网络拥堵情况、手续费等,选择最适合自己需求的合约。此外,要选择拥有良好技术支持和专业团队的合约,确保在使用中如遇问题能获得及时帮助。
4. 区块链钱包合约的法律合规问题
随着区块链技术的兴起,法律和监管的框架也在不断演进。区块链钱包合约涉及到的法律合规问题越来越受到关注。首先,用户需要关注所在国家或地区的法律政策。不同国家对数字资产和智能合约的法律地位不同,因此了解当地的法规是使用钱包合约的前提。
其次,合约的设计需符合相关法规。钱包合约在设计时,应考虑合规性,如反洗钱(AML)和客户身份识别(KYC)。确保合约的功能与当地法律相符,有助于降低法律风险。
此外,用户在使用合约时应重视隐私问题。某些合约可能会收集用户的数据,用户应确认该合约是否符合数据保护法律,并了解其数据使用和存储政策。
总结
总的来说,区块链钱包合约作为区块链技术的重要应用之一,展现出巨大的潜力和广泛的应用前景。无论是在安全性、灵活性,还是在去中心化金融等场景中,钱包合约都为用户提供了新的资产管理方式。
然而,用户在评估、选择和使用钱包合约时,须保持警惕,充分了解相关的法律合规问题,以确保财富安全。随着技术和法规的不断发展,未来的区块链钱包合约将愈加成熟,也将引领我们迎接更高效、安全的数字资产管理时代。
